Step-by-step explanation:
H(x) = 64x - 16x²
<u>Find the value of x when the ball reaches its maximum height.</u>
<u />
Since the largest degree in this equation is two, this function represents a parabola. We can find the maximum height of the ball at the vertex of the quadratic.
In H(x) = 64x - 16x², rearrange the powers from greatest to least:
Vertex: [-b/2a, f(-b/2a)]
Substitute a and b into the x-value of the vertex: -b/2a.
The vertex of the parabola is at x = 2, with a maximum height of H(2).
